python dataframe 写入 excel

    科技2025-09-06  9

    项目中用到把DateFrame写入Excel,其中pandas中的几个参数非常有用。

    这里以实例说明:

     

    import pandas as pd

     

    #create some Pandas DateFrame from some data

    df1=pd.DataFrame({'Data1':[1,2,3,4,5,6,7]})

    df2=pd.DataFrame({'Data2':[8,9,10,11,12,13]})

    df3=pd.DataFrame({'Data3':[14,15,16,17,18]})

    All=[df1,df2,df3]

    #create a Pandas Excel writer using xlswriter

    writer=pd.ExcelWriter('test.xlsx')

     

    df1.to_excel(writer,sheet_name='Data1',startcol=0,index=False)

    df2.to_excel(writer,sheet_name='Data1',startcol=1,index=False)

    df3.to_excel(writer,sheet_name='Data3',index=False)

    写入的结果:

    sheet1中的数据,其中sheet_name=Data1

     

    Data1Data218293104115126137 

     

    sheet2中的数据,其中sheet_name=Data3

    Data31415161718
    Processed: 0.008, SQL: 8